本文目录导读:
SFTP(Secure File Transfer Protocol)是一种基于加密的协议,用于在计算机之间安全地传输文件,它允许用户通过安全的通道进行文件传输,而无需担心数据被窃取或篡改,我们将深入探讨SFTP的基本概念、工作原理、应用场景以及如何确保其安全性。
SFTP的基本概念
SFTP是一种基于SSL(Secure Sockets Layer)或TLS(Transport Layer Security)的协议,用于在客户端和服务器之间建立安全的通信通道,它支持多种协议,如FTP和Telnet,并提供了加密功能,使得文件传输过程更加安全。
SFTP的工作原理
SFTP的工作原理是通过建立一个加密的通道,将数据从客户端传输到服务器,客户端使用用户名和密码与服务器建立连接,客户端会发送一个请求,要求服务器提供一个加密密钥,服务器会响应这个请求,提供一个加密密钥,用于后续的数据传输,客户端使用这个加密密钥对数据进行加密,然后将加密后的数据发送到服务器,服务器收到数据后,会使用相同的加密密钥解密数据,并将解密后的数据返回给客户端,这样,客户端和服务器就可以在加密的通道中传输数据了。
SFTP的应用场景
SFTP广泛应用于各种场景,如远程文件管理、备份和恢复、企业级应用等,在远程桌面连接时,我们可以使用SFTP来传输文件,而无需使用其他方式,如FTP或HTTP,SFTP还可以用于备份和恢复系统,因为文件传输过程是加密的,可以防止数据被窃取或篡改。
如何确保SFTP的安全性
为了确保SFTP的安全性,我们需要采取一些措施,我们需要使用强密码和多因素认证来保护我们的凭证,我们需要定期更新软件和驱动程序,以确保它们都是最新的版本,以防止潜在的安全漏洞,我们还可以使用防火墙和入侵检测系统来监控网络流量,以便及时发现可疑活动,我们还需要定期备份数据,以防万一发生意外情况导致数据丢失。
SFTP是一种安全的文件传输协议,它通过加密通道实现数据的传输,它具有广泛的应用场景,并且可以通过一些措施来确保其安全性,随着黑客技术的不断进步,我们仍然需要不断提高自己的网络安全意识,并采取相应的措施来保护自己的数据。